Nikolas Rimikis
198393d439
perf(nextcloud): read file as Uint8List
...
according to comment by a dart dev: https://stackoverflow.com/questions/73478943/flutter-dart-read-portions-of-file-as-bytes-rather-than-listint#comment129764806_73478943
it will allways return Uint8List
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
3d545a555a
perf(dynamite_runtime): avoid unnecessary Uint8List.toList
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
ed6502697a
perf(nextcloud): use stream based body decoding
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
52e6ef96f5
refactor(nextcloud): use avoid creating unnecessary streams
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
d072c91ff1
style(nextcloud): cleaup header map handling
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
9d243580cb
style(nextcloud): cleanup unnecessary cast
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
962102407d
refactor(dynamite,neon,nextcloud): use dart 3.1 utf8.encode as Uint8List
...
While the entire utf8 converter has been switched to Uint8List the type annotation still remains List<int> for this release.
Adding the downcast as this behavior is what we need.
A future dart release should also change the type annotations triggering a linter rule.
see: https://github.com/dart-lang/sdk/issues/52801
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Kate
86bb58d813
Merge pull request #597 from nextcloud/fix/capabilities
...
Fix/capabilities
1 year ago
jld3103
2c06d0d56a
chore(neon): Adjust
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
faab2e712f
fix(tool,nextcloud): Fix capabilities
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
Kate
c96b5b6626
Merge pull request #595 from nextcloud/feature/dynamite-javascript-content-type
...
feat(dynamite): Support application/javascript response
1 year ago
jld3103
c9ad9648eb
feat(dynamite): Support application/javascript response
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
Kate
073e449733
Merge pull request #589 from nextcloud/feature/user-status-icons
...
Feature/user status icons
1 year ago
jld3103
0cb48a8892
fix(neon): Fix user status heartbeat
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
254102b746
feat(neon): Use user status icons
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
440b0beedb
feat(tool,neon): Implement server icons
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
Nikolas Rimikis
2c500ae406
Merge pull request #590 from nextcloud/fix/files_bloc_propagation
...
fix(neon_files): bloc propagation
1 year ago
Kate
afb8895d5d
Merge pull request #584 from nextcloud/refactor/files-task-progress
...
Refactor/files task progress
1 year ago
Nikolas Rimikis
75504708ab
fix(neon_files): bloc propagation
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
jld3103
5379f23eec
refactor(neon_files): Use WebDAV client progress logic
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
a545b8003f
fix(nextcloud): Fix WebDAV progress
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
Kate
f8d0a3779f
Merge pull request #582 from nextcloud/fix/dynamite-conflicting-variables
...
Fix/dynamite conflicting variables
1 year ago
jld3103
ea947bd652
fix(nextcloud): Regenerate
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
768f8edaf9
fix(dynamite): Fix conflicting variables
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
Kate
547a34bc29
Merge pull request #580 from nextcloud/fix/build-app-docker
...
fix(tool): Fix building app in docker
1 year ago
jld3103
8c785cd9a0
fix(tool): Fix building app in docker
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
Kate
4b5a0b5ce5
Merge pull request #579 from nextcloud/update/flutter-3.13
...
Update/flutter 3.13
1 year ago
jld3103
e2ba362baf
chore(dynamite,neon,neon_files,neon_news,nextcloud): Fix linter complaints
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
1c576a6005
feat(neon_lints): Enable new available rules
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
e2541d378b
chore: Update to flutter 3.13
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
Nikolas Rimikis
726a2f602a
Merge pull request #578 from nextcloud/fix/licence
...
fix(neon_lints): add licence
1 year ago
Nikolas Rimikis
37eb481477
fix(neon_lints): add licence
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
88fd6d6290
Merge pull request #576 from nextcloud/feat/linting
...
Feat/linting
1 year ago
Nikolas Rimikis
19b3b9260c
fix(dynamite,neon_files,neon_news,neon_lints): fix lints
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
70d7cefa9d
fix(dynamite,nextcloud): unnecessary_breaks
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
a1f2d72483
chore(app,dynamite,dynamite_runtime,file_icons,neon,neon_files,neon_news,neon_notes,neon_notifications,neon_lints,nextcloud,sort_box): use custom neon_lints package
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
87fe6408a2
feat(neon_lints): add custom linting rules
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
73770655dc
Merge pull request #556 from nextcloud/reactor/files_app
...
Reactor/files app
1 year ago
Nikolas Rimikis
a7b0ddaf75
refactor(neon_files): make UpladTask and DownloadTask inherrit from a sealed Task class
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Kate
e7a35bdac6
Merge pull request #569 from nextcloud/feature/dev-container-all-domains
...
feat(tool): Allow all domains in dev container
1 year ago
Kate
91512a9363
Merge pull request #558 from nextcloud/feature/setup-install-from-workspace
...
feat(tool): Install setup tools from workspace
1 year ago
Kate
cdf7844df4
Merge pull request #570 from nextcloud/fix/push-notifications
...
fix(neon): Fix not receiving push notifications
1 year ago
jld3103
b90bcdc225
fix(neon): Fix not receiving push notifications
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
c8d1508958
feat(tool): Allow all domains in dev container
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
jld3103
3f1be7a3e5
feat(tool): Install setup tools from workspace
...
Signed-off-by: jld3103 <jld3103yt@gmail.com>
1 year ago
Kate
176cceada1
Merge pull request #565 from nextcloud/fix/flaky-tests
...
test(neon,nextcloud): Fix flaky tests
1 year ago
Nikolas Rimikis
4bd5a029be
refactor(neon_files): move task progress into FileDetails
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
3cb05179af
feat(neon_files): increase precision of upload/download tasks
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Nikolas Rimikis
4bff5547a1
feat(neon_files): add FileDetails constructors
...
Signed-off-by: Nikolas Rimikis <rimikis.nikolas@gmail.com>
1 year ago
Kate
978f7fca32
Merge pull request #564 from nextcloud/update/license
...
chore: Switch to AGPL-3.0
1 year ago